6.1 Description of the pump (Fig. 1.1 Appendix on page II)

The UPE high-efficiency pump is a series of glandless pumps
with integrated electronic regulation, which enables the perfor-
mance of the pump to be adapted automatically to variable
load states of the system.
This ensures optimum system efficiency in all operating modes
and with all loads, as well as the highest possible energy savings
on the pump side.
The regulation module has an axial design and can be found on
the motor casing, with up to three types of automatic output
adjustment (depending on the type of pump):
6.1.1 Types of differential pressure regulation
The selectable types of regulation are:
p-c: The electronics maintain the differential pressure
produced by the pump constant at the selected differential
pressure setpoint HS (up to the maximum characteristic
curve) across the entire permissible volume flow range.

The key advantages of this electronic regulation are:
Energy savings and reduced operating costs at the same
time,
Reduction of flow noise,
Fewer overflow valves required, e.g. in static heating cir-
cuits.
p-v: The electronics change the differential pressure set-
point value to be maintained by the pump linearly between
½Hs and Hs. The differential pressure setpoint decreases
or increases depending on the discharge rate.
